'Long live the emperor', this is the title that Liu Che likes to use.
The custom of shouting "Long live the emperor" existed in the Han Dynasty. When Emperor Gaozu Liu Bang entered the palace, all the ministers in the hall shouted "Long live the emperor".
But this was not exclusive to the emperor. When he visited Songshan Mountain before, Liu Che insisted that three "Long live" should be heard in the mountains. And the title of "Long live" also began to be sacred.
The three cheers of "Long live the emperor" also evolved into "Songhu, Long live the emperor" and "Shanhu, Long live the emperor", becoming a ritual to praise the emperor.
